If I could snap my fingers and eat anywhere in San Diego for lunch I would choose to eat at Roots.  Their food is beautiful. They use local and organic foods.  They are very "green" and use biodegradable supplies.  They also donate 5% of their profits to environmental organizations.  Their menu is small but fabulous (salads/sandwiches/wraps/drinks).  They have ingredients like hummus, portobella, avocado, mock chicken, artichoke, peanut butter/jelly, carrots, apples, yogurt, granola, salsa/chips, fruit, tea, soy milk and even fresh flowers!

Roots is a couple blocks from the beach on Newport.  I love how you order your food through a window.  You have the option to sit outside on Newport or inside at one of the cute little tables which are in the corner of "Rock, Paper, Scissors"

Kind Food For Kind Folks.  Love it!  Go there the next time you are in OB.

The Healthiest food in OB and possibly all of San Diego.  Each time I visit the friendly people at Roots I'm continually impressed with the quality and freshness of the food.  You really do get your moneys worth because everything is made from scratch with locally sourced produce, most of which comes from the OB farmers market and locally baked bread!

My favorite sandwich is the Thai Peanut wrap with "mock" chicken.  It's so delicious and even comes with a little salad!  Awesome!  Make sure you try the horchata to quench your thirst, and finally, finish off your meal with the "Hippie Bar".  Trust me, while the name implies nuts and berries and something without flavor, the actual treat is loaded with chocolate and is moist, satisfying and delicious.  You can now eat indoors as well as outdoors so Roots is a great choice in any weather.

Kudos go out to these folks for their use of environmentally friendly packaging for to-go items.  We are talking about recycled napkins, cups made from corn starch which are biodegradable, and the list goes on.  They go the extra step to be a sustainable business and it shows.
